Is the Larger Business Loan one that requires security?
Asset security is necessary for funding of more than $150,000. This can be done as a result of an charge against assets and can be registered on the PPSR or making as a caveat.
A personal or director’s guarantee is a guarantee to pay off a credit line that is generally based rather than stating the security of a specific asset. The person who signs the guarantee is personally responsible if the business the borrower fails to re-pay the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online central register operated by the New Zealand Government. It contains security interests that are registered for personal property (including objects or assets). The PPSR allows the priority of personal property assigned according to the date the security interest that is registered.
The caveat can be described as a formal form of document to offer notice of a legal claim on a property.

Application process
Do I have the right to receive funds?
You may apply for an company loan if you
- are a New Zealand Citizen (or Permanent Resident)
- are at least 18 years old, own a New Zealand company (with a valid NZBN/IRD)
- can demonstrate at least 6 months of trading (for for the unsecured loan $5K – $100K) or three years of trade (for the Larger Business Loan $100K up to $500K)
How do I apply?
The application process is simple and simple. Just complete the online application within a couple minutes, and an experienced business loan specialist will contact you to guide you.
To be eligible for up to $100,000, you’ll require the right identification documents (valid Driver’s Licence) along with a valid NZBN/IRD and at least 6 months of bank statements.
Otherwise, for larger loan sizes, you’ll need:
$100K – $250K: Details of application, including credit consent, 6-12 months of bank statements, IRD statement (if credit is over $150K).
$250K to $500K: Details for application including credit consent, 12 month bank accounts, the IRD statement, last 2 years finalised financial statements, plus interim financials for the current financial year, Aged Payables and Aged Receivables Summary.

Fees & repayments
How do you charge for the cost of a business loan?
When you apply for one of our company loans, we’ll assess the risk assessment of your company and provide an individualised offer, including the amount of the loan, the duration and the interest rates. It is a company loan is a loan that is priced upfront and you’ll be aware in advance of the total amount you will have to pay, including interest rates, fees or charges.
What is the basis for the rate I am charged?
Business loan interest rates depend on several factors including the amount borrowed, what business assets the money are used to purchase in addition to the industry that the company operates in, how long the company is in operation as well as what percentage of the business has enough cash flow to support the loan, and general well-being as well as creditworthiness company.
What are the cost?
There are no hidden fees for our business loans. You’ll be aware of the amount you need to pay and when, starting from the first day. There’s no compounding interest, and the loan comes with no additional fees (as long as you make your payments in time).
We don’t charge an Application Fee. You are able to make an application for loans with with no upfront cost or the obligation to take action.
The Origination Fee is the cost associated with the setting up and management of the loan. You are only charged this fee if you choose to proceed with the loan. The Origination Fee for us is 2.5% of the loan amount.
Can I pay off the loan earlier?
You can choose to repay the entire amount of your loan early at any time.
If you are deciding to do this please contact our helpful company credit professionals. We will provide you with details on repayment as well as an early payout amount. This will be calculated as the total of the principal balance and accrued interest to the time of early payment in addition to 1.5 percent of the remaining principal plus any outstanding fees.
How do you make repayments work?
In order to help you avoid missing payment dates and to align with your cash flow cycle we provide payments that are either weekly or daily. These are automatically deducted from your nominated company account.

About business loans
How do you define asset-based lending (a secured loan)?
Asset-based borrowing is when a company owner makes use of an asset they own to get the loan. The asset could be an individual asset, such as the family home, or a business asset like a truck as well as a piece of machine.
The vast majority of lending institutions, including the major banks, prefer to guarantee loans against assets. If you’re having trouble paying back the loan then your assets could be transferred to the lender. In essence, it’s means of securing new financing making use of the value of what you already have.
Are I need security to get a company loan?
For loans of up to $150,000, the requirement for asset security is not required prior to the loan’s access but we require a personal guarantee. need the personal guarantee. If you adhere to your loan obligations (as specified in your loan contract document) Asset security is not required. For loans over $150,000 generally, there is personal guarantee and security that is in the form an asset charge.
